Simulador de naves espaciales

Virtual Satellite
Software Libre
Trial
Offline
https://sourceforge.net/

El futuro de la ingeniería de sistemas basados ​​en modelos para misiones espaciales.

Virtual Satellite es un proyecto interno de DLR que comenzó en 2007. Como su nombre lo indica, el enfoque inicial fue apoyar las actividades de ensamblaje, integración y prueba de naves espaciales (AIT) con una maqueta digital y simulación. Muy pronto, el enfoque del proyecto Virtual Satellite cambió de AIT a las primeras fases de la vida de una nave espacial, a la Instalación de Ingeniería Concurrente (CEF). Aquí nacen la nave espacial y sus misiones y, por lo tanto, se necesitaba una herramienta inteligente que permita a los ingenieros trabajar en colaboración. Una representación digital compartida de la nave espacial. Permitir la colaboración es una de las características clave de Virtual Satellite.

La continua evolución e integración de la familia de software Virtual Satellite construye la columna vertebral de las actividades MBSE de DLR. Aquí se evalúan, implementan y envían los últimos resultados de la investigación a los proyectos. La familia de Virtual Satellite contiene las versiones 3 y 4, algunas de las mejores y más avanzadas herramientas para apoyar el diseño, desarrollo y producción de la nave espacial del mañana. La mayoría de las herramientas se basan en la plataforma de cliente enriquecido Eclipse (RCP) y están escritas en Java dentro de un entorno de ingeniería de software de última generación.

Virtual Satellite 3 apoya principalmente el trabajo en CEF. Fue desarrollado para mejorar la colaboración durante los estudios de diseño y para permitir a los ingenieros crear una maqueta digital común de su nave espacial. Presenta un modelo de datos simple que se adapta a las necesidades de los ingenieros y que se adapta perfectamente a la forma en que se realizan los estudios de CEF. Incluso bastante simple, sigue el paradigma de dejar que los ingenieros sean creativos. Virtual Satellite es fácil de usar y no distrae a los ingenieros de su tarea original de diseñar una nave espacial. Además del día a día en el CEF, Virtual Satellite 3 también ha aprovechado algunas nuevas direcciones pioneras, como la verificación continua o los enfoques de configuración visual de naves espaciales. El software se ha desarrollado en estrecha colaboración con el departamento de Segmento espacial de análisis de sistemas. Lo abrimos a la comunidad y está disponible para descargar de forma gratuita.

Un modelo de datos flexible y extensible.

Virtual Satellite 4 es la nueva evolución y plataforma reconstruida. Con un modelo de datos personalizable, puede adaptarse a las diversas necesidades de las tareas de ingeniería individuales y los requisitos del proyecto. En lugar del enfoque histórico de tratar de crear el modelo de datos y el lenguaje de ingeniería del sistema que pueda manejar todas las tareas posibles, el nuevo enfoque se centra en las necesidades que conducen a aplicaciones simples y fáciles de usar. El modelo de datos de una aplicación Virtual Satellite 4 puede ampliarse mediante un concepto. Se puede descargar de una tienda conceptual y activar cuando sea necesario. Tal concepto es un conjunto de extensiones de modelo de datos más funcionalidad para proporcionar interfaces de usuario correspondientes y más funcionalidad. Todo esto junto con este mecanismo de extensión basado en conceptos ofrece Virtual Satellite 4 en tres líneas de productos:

  • "Virtual Satellite 4 Core" como producto de referencia. Proporciona todo lo que necesita para comenzar a diseñar su sistema. La funcionalidad adicional necesaria puede ser descargada de la tienda conceptual o implementada por sus expertos utilizando las Herramientas de desarrollo de satélite virtual. Ofrecen un lenguaje de dominio específico (DSL) para describir fácilmente la extensión de su modelo de datos. Los generadores de código usarán esa descripción para ofrecerle una implementación inicial en funcionamiento para comenzar a trabajar con su extensión.
  • "Virtual Satellite 4 Research", basado en Virtual Satellite Core. Los estudiantes de doctorado crean sus propias aplicaciones individuales con su prueba de conceptos. Es el patio de recreo y el cajón de arena para experimentos, que está separado de las aplicaciones y sistemas productivos. Aquí las fallas y los choques no dañan los sistemas productivos y abren el espacio para experimentos y resultados científicos.
  • Los proyectos "Powered by Virtual Satellite 4". Estas son las aplicaciones personalizadas, como la de nuestro proyecto interno S2tep. Aquí la funcionalidad se adapta estrechamente a las demandas del proyecto. En esta publicación (Publicación) encontrará más detalles sobre cómo usamos Virtual Satellite 4 para apoyar el proyecto S2tep.

 

Virtual Satellite es un software de código abierto DLR para ingeniería de sistemas basados ​​en modelos MBSE.

Una de las principales características de Virtual Satellite es el modelo de datos modular, que se puede personalizar fácilmente según sus necesidades personales. Hoy, ya hay varias versiones diferentes:

  • Virtual Satellite 4 - Core es el punto de entrada para comenzar a desarrollar y la base para todas las demás versiones
  • Virtual Satellite 4 - CEF es una versión especializada para el uso en nuestras instalaciones de ingeniería concurrente
  • Virtual Satellite 4 - FDIR es una versión de investigación para detección de fallas, aislamiento y recuperación
  • Virtual Satellite 4 - DEV IDE es un Eclipse IDE especial para el desarrollo fácil y rápido de Virtual Satellite.

Este proyecto contiene los artefactos desplegados del ecosistema de satélite virtual. También se proporcionan descargas para Virtual Satellite 4 Core.

Los artefactos de Virtual Satellite contienen compilaciones p2 para:

  • Desarrollos diarios de desarrollo
  • Construcciones de integración regulares
  • Compilaciones de lanzamiento específicas